Search More


St. Louis County Library, Lewis & Clark Branch

9909 Lewis & Clark Blvd. North St. Louis County, MO 63136 | Jennings | 314-868-0331
Related Stories (2)

Related Stories

  • Daily RFT: Architecture
    Mid-century modernist architecture sits at the crossroads in St. Louis. It is reaching the age where many of its detractors consider it obsolete, a relic not attuned to the needs of...
  • Daily RFT: Arts
    The Lewis & Clark Branch of the St. Louis County Library is an architectural marvel -- a midcentury, modernist design with stained glass windows. But it's also 50 years old and 20 percent...